Christmas Home Tour 2023

December 25, 2023 · In: Design, Holiday

What an amazing holiday! I’ve got a little Christmas home tour to share with you to give you an insight into what it feels like around here! I hope this season has you feeling cozy and loved! 

We’ve fallen into a nice rhythm of traditions over the years which includes lots of hot cocoa after school days, making cookies for Santa and neighbors over the break and playing board games/with presents ALL day long on Christmas together. Sometimes we add in something like an evening drive or walk to see lights but this is a busy time of year plus a cold or flu could set us off our plans. For this reason I try to keep the “musts list” short. 

Decorating with candy canes or those green wrapper/chocolate mint Andie’s candies feels decadent and costs a few dollars. I’m a sucker for holiday mugs and this one is new for this year. Little napkins from Homegoods added a little cheer as well! It’s fun to hunt for these little joys over the fall months.

Photos of past Christmas’ are especially a favorite around here. I love the memories we have of Christmas in Seattle when we lived there or visit my parents. We would visit the Pike’s Market area for a sushi lunch and then grab a drink at a hidden locals bar where the wait staff is rude and the drinks are stiff! 🙂 Then a little shopping for flowers for my Mom and maybe a little Patagonia or Free People stop. I always ask another tourist to take our photo at the front of the market and the kiss pose is my go-to. I highly recommend. 🙂

The Elf is a favorite here. We set a recurring alarm on our phones for 9:30pm during December. The kids just live for this and we oblige. I’ve got a bunch of ideas on this Instagram Video post if you want some inspo!

A very sweet Nativity Scene for the family room to remind us of all the good things this season brings and where it all comes from.

I had heard the Queen of England, Queen Elizabeth, did not allow Monopoly to be played at the castle because it brings out the worst in people or something to that effect. Well, it’s a HUGE hit at our house and our very competitive real estate moguls in the making are obsessed. We had the junior edition but the classic version is just too good now that the big boys are older. We played for HOURS on Christmas! 

We literally plan a family fight, I mean family photo each year, knowing it’s going to be a sweaty, frustrating challenge. Ha! I mean, getting the outfits together, me running back and forth to the timer and Chris bribing kids with promises of a special treat. I gotta say though that it’s worth it. Sometimes we do a mini session with a photographer and sometimes it’s the self timer at home.

I LOVE getting photo cards from our friends SO much and I hope they love ours as well.

Our diffusers make it so glowy and extra magical during the holidays. More on diffusing HERE.

Each year I have a cute holiday label for Thieves Cleaner, that I send to my customers. We use it to clean our whole home and I love having beautiful labels to gift! More on cleaning HERE.

Last year we started a kids’ room flocked tree and it’s a treat! I love the flocked look and making it super colorful in their room. It’s extra magical before bedtime each night.

The famous “Creepy Santas!” I saw a ton of them in a bin at The Round Top Antiques Fair years ago and regretted not getting them. Each season thereafter, I’d look and then last year, when shopping with my friend, Shelley, she miraculously spotted them!!! I set them in the book bin this year and they have added a sweet bit of nostalgia.

Making cookies for Santa and our neighbors is a favorite pastime of ours!
